Budget Planning for Your Remodeling Project

How can homeowners effectively budget for their remodeling projects? Initially, they need to determine the project's scope, distinguishing between necessary improvements and optional additions. Developing a concrete vision aids in organizing spending priorities. Next, homeowners must research and gather estimates from contractors, ensuring they account for labor, materials, and potential unexpected costs. It's wise to set aside an extra 10-20% of the overall budget for contingencies, since unexpected problems frequently occur during renovations.

Property owners ought to consider financing options when required, such as personal loans or home equity lines of credit, to confirm they maintain sufficient funds. Comparing different contractors and their proposals can result in better pricing and value. Lastly, regularly evaluating the budget throughout the project preserves financial control and enables adjustments as needed. By applying these recommendations, homeowners can create a realistic budget that encourages a successful remodeling experience.

Questions and Answers

What Is the Expected Duration of a Typical Remodeling Project?

A typical remodeling project can take any time from a few weeks to several months, based on the scope and complexity of the work. Elements like design changes, permits, and material availability also impact the timeline.

What Actions Should I Take if I Surpass My Budget?

When spending exceeds the budget, you should reevaluate priorities, identify non-critical expenses to remove, and consider funding alternatives. Direct communication with contractors about financial limitations can result in adapted strategies or other options.

Is Living in My Home During Renovation Work Feasible?

Living in your home during renovation work is achievable, though it varies based on the scale of the project. Careful planning and consistent contractor communication can limit interruptions and preserve safety throughout the renovation period.

Which Permits Are Required for Remodeling Projects?

Usually, property owners need building, electrical, and plumbing permits, and at times zoning permits for home improvement projects. Local requirements vary, so it's important to consult municipal regulations and authorities prior to initiating any home improvements.

How Can I Find Reliable Contractors in My Area?

To discover reliable contractors, it's advisable to ask for recommendations from relatives and friends, examine online reviews, check local directories, and verify credentials through licensing boards. Additionally, getting multiple quotes can help to determine quality and competitiveness.
